So, here I am, 6 skills 250, working on the last one. And I wistfully follow the threads on Aid Grimel knowing that it would be a very long time before could ever start it - you see its the flags that hold me back.
I had heaps and heaps of fun working on PoTC when it was new. I did most of the parts myself, even though they were tradable and some of my skills were weak. It was tremendously fun and rewarding. But that's just it, the parts are all tradeable. And everyone buys the parts in the bazaar and has this earring now. It somewhat diminishes it.
I finished my shawl quite a while ago. I love it, yay!
One post in the Aid Grimel thread has me curious, are parts of this MQable? Ugh if so. But that's beside the point.
And so, with 1750 just around the corner, I find myself wishing for a quest that is specifically targetted at those who tradeskill, and not at ONLY uberguilders who tradeskill. Something like, requires all 7 skills (maybe 8, toss in fishing). Must be at 250 (modified or unmodified) to attempt. No resulting parts are droppable. And DOESN'T require you to be in the server's top 3 guilds to even begin. Just a tradeskillers quest.
I am in a family type guild, average level 62. We do raid regularly but only a couple days a week, can do some good stuff, don't get me wrong. But most the folks in my guild are all adults with jobs and kids and other outside responsibilities. We don't all live and breath EQ every moment of the day. We will eventually get some of these flags. But probably not all.
But I think a quest for the rest of the 1750ers, those who can't or don't want to join a hard core raiding guild is really lacking here. There should be something for those who love tradeskills, and have sought that form of enjoyment out of the game, who are perhaps more casual players in the raiding front. Or who maybe prefer a good group in a dungeon with 5 friends over a raid of 60+ hardcore people.
